By day, Vito is just an ordinary pug with an ordinary family.
By night, he becomes Vito Bandito, King of the Bandits.
Every evening at exactly eight o’clock, Vito slips away to meet his crew in the North End of Boston, where outlaw dogs rule fire hydrants, run sock-stealing rings, and dream big. But when the Bandits catch the irresistible scent of fresh cookies drifting from a neighborhood bakery, they hatch their boldest plan yet: the ultimate cookie heist.
The plan is clever. The timing is perfect.
Until everything goes wrong.
When one of their own is taken to the dog pound, Vito must choose between walking away with a belly full of treats or risking everything for his famiglia. What follows is a daring rescue, an unexpected discovery, and a reminder that sometimes bandits save more than they steal.
Vito Bandito: Cookie Heist is a playful, heartfelt adventure about loyalty, courage, and the power of choosing kindness, even when temptation is strong.
Short Chapter Book- Easy Reading
JOCELYN’S FAVORITE CHILDREN’S BOOKS:
- Be You!– Peter H. Reynolds
- A beautiful reminder to embrace who you are. It celebrates what makes every child one of a kind, encouraging them to be brave, kind, and unapologetically themselves—a message I wholeheartedly believe in.
- Oh the Places You’ll Go!– Dr.Suess
- An inspiring reminder that life is full of possibilities. Its playful rhymes and powerful message encourage kids (and adults) to dream big, embrace challenges, and keep moving forward—plus, I’ve always loved a good rhyme!
- ALL PETE THE CAT BOOKS– Eric Litwin, James Dean, and Kimberly Dean
- They teach kids to go with the flow, stay positive, and keep moving forward—all with a fun, laid-back attitude. The catchy rhymes and cool illustrations make every story a reminder that life is all good, no matter what comes your way!
- I Like Myself!– Karen Beaumont
- A fun, energetic celebration of self-love and confidence. The playful rhymes and bold illustrations remind kids to embrace their uniqueness, quirks, and all.
